Output 3114c18d6d8c51d16bd27c348b753800095fbf1461fcb76ea3d2669ae4f96424:1

value
1702840
script pubkey
OP_0 OP_PUSHBYTES_20 1dab9cdc67bd9d5f0aaae092a2d54daf60803f2a
address
ltc1qrk4eehr8hkw47z42uzf2942d4asgq0e2ev3tqn
transaction
3114c18d6d8c51d16bd27c348b753800095fbf1461fcb76ea3d2669ae4f96424
spent
true